Located in the southeast edge of the Inner Mongolia Plateau, Guyuan County is a cool temperate semi-arid continental monsoon climate, cold and dry climate, less rainfall and evaporation, the natural ecological environment is extremely fragile. Due to cleared for farming for many years, overgrazing and deforestation, leading to desertification and soil erosion, serious ecological degradation, this area is the typical fragile ecological zone ecotone. Over the past two decades, ecological construction and climate change has a profound impact on land use pattern of the region, but also a profound impact on the fragile ecological environment of the region. In this paper, we choose to research the eco-environmental vulnerability, with the analysis of Guyuan County agricultural land use and its dynamic changes and the driving force of agricultural land use change, make the qualitative analysis of the drivers on the fragile ecological environment from natural and anthropogenic factors two aspects, Provide the basis for the choice of agricultural land use vulnerability assessment factor, to determine the eco-environmental vulnerability evaluation index system, with the use of GIS in data preprocessing, built an eco-environmental vulnerability evaluation model,using the analytic hierarchy process and expert scoring method to determine the weights of the various ecological factors, analysis and evaluate the impact of various of factors on the ecological environment systematically, data standardization, and make evaluation factors into a comprehensive evaluation indicators, overlay and output a fragile ecological environment index map. On the basis of the above work, we conduct a household questionnaire survey, through interviews and informal discussions with fanners in five villages, explore the ways and measures of agricultural land use ecological adaptability. Combined with the successful experience of the ecological construction in Guyuan County nearly20years, speculated that the trend of agricultural development, economic and social developments in the next10years. Give full consideration to the factors of scientific and technological progress, put forward to the Guyuan County future land use of ecological adaptation strategy.The paper is composed of six chapters.
